Solved

TINYMCE Textbox not updating

Posted on 2012-03-21
6
705 Views
Last Modified: 2012-03-27
Hi,

I have a textbox that is using TinyMce and it works fine, but when I enter in text and then click save it doesn't make it through to my SQL string to insert into the database.

Below is the code for my textbox

<asp:TextBox ID="txtArticle" Enabled="false" runat="server" Height="250px" TextMode="MultiLine" Width="600px"></asp:TextBox>

Then the code below is the code Im using in the codebehind

string ShortArticle = txtPlainText.Text;

string query1 = "UPDATE database SET shortArticle='" + ShortArticle + "' WHERE newsid='" + newsid + "'";

Any help would be greatly appreciated

Regards

Michael
0
Comment
Question by:hayward03
  • 4
  • 2
6 Comments
 
LVL 14

Expert Comment

by:dejaanbu
ID: 37748928
try this,

have a javascript function
<script type="text/javascript">
function UpdateTextArea() {                                     
            tinyMCE.triggerSave(false, true);
        }
</script>

Open in new window


call it before submitting,
<asp:Button ID="itheButton" runat="server" OnClientClick="UpdateTextArea();"  />

Open in new window

0
 

Author Comment

by:hayward03
ID: 37748960
Hi,

Thank you for your help, but this didnt work either...no error, but just didnt update.

Regards

Michael
0
 
LVL 14

Expert Comment

by:dejaanbu
ID: 37751676
your tinymce textbox name is  "txtArticle" or "txtPlainText" ?
0
Announcing the Most Valuable Experts of 2016

MVEs are more concerned with the satisfaction of those they help than with the considerable points they can earn. They are the types of people you feel privileged to call colleagues. Join us in honoring this amazing group of Experts.

 

Author Comment

by:hayward03
ID: 37751707
Sorry the code is below:

<asp:TextBox ID="txtArticle" Enabled="false" runat="server" Height="250px" TextMode="MultiLine" Width="600px"></asp:TextBox>

string ShortArticle = txtArticle.Text;

string query1 = "UPDATE database SET shortArticle='" + ShortArticle + "' WHERE newsid='" + newsid + "'";
0
 

Accepted Solution

by:
hayward03 earned 0 total points
ID: 37751869
Hi,

This was me being DUMB as I just saw that I had textbox enabled="false"

Regards

Michael
0
 

Author Closing Comment

by:hayward03
ID: 37770355
I solved my own issue
0

Featured Post

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
IIS redirect 1 77
imap mails 1 25
Modal Popup Extender control 1 35
asp.net mvc , views, hidden values ? 2 16
I recently went through the process of creating a Calendar Control of events with the basis of using a database to keep track of the dates that are selectable, one requirement was to have the selected date pop-up in a simple lightbox.  At first this…
The article shows the basic steps of integrating an HTML theme template into an ASP.NET MVC project
With Secure Portal Encryption, the recipient is sent a link to their email address directing them to the email laundry delivery page. From there, the recipient will be required to enter a user name and password to enter the page. Once the recipient …
A short tutorial showing how to set up an email signature in Outlook on the Web (previously known as OWA). For free email signatures designs, visit https://www.mail-signatures.com/articles/signature-templates/?sts=6651 If you want to manage em…

789 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question